Malocclusion: Disease of Civilization, Part III

Written By Low Fat High Protein Foods on Sabtu, 10 Oktober 2009 | 14.40

Normal Human Occlusion

In 1967, a team of geneticists and anthropologists published an extensive study of a population of Brazilian hunter-gatherers called the Xavante (1). They made a large number of physical measurements, including of the skull and jaws. Of 146 Xavante examined, 95% had "ideal" occlusion, while the 5% with malocclusion had nothing more than mild cro
wding of the incisors (front teeth). The authors wrote:
Characteristically, the Xavante adults exhibited broad dental arches, almost perfectly aligned teeth, end-to-end bite, and extensive dental attrition [tooth wear].
In the same paper, the author presents occlusion statistics for three other cultures. According to the papers he cites, in Japan, the prevalence of malocclusion was 59%, and in the US (Utah), it was 64%. He also mentions another native group living near the Xavante, part of the Bakairi tribe, living at a government post and presumably eating processed food. The prevalence of malocclusion was 45% in this group.

In 1998, Dr. Brian Palmer (DDS) published a paper describing some of the collections of historical skulls he had examined over the years (2):
...I reviewed an additional twenty prehistoric skulls, some dated at 70,000 years old and stored in the Anthropology Department at the University of Kansas. Those skulls also exhibited positive [good] occlusions, minimal decay, broad hard palates, and "U-shaped" arches.

The final evaluations were of 370 skulls preserved at the Smithsonian Institution in Washington, D.C. The skulls were those of prehistoric North American plains Indians and more contemporary American skulls dating from the 1920s to 1940s. The prehistoric skulls exhibited the same features as mentioned above, whereas a significant destruction and collapse of the oral cavity were evident in the collection of the more recent skulls. Many of these more recent skulls revealed severe periodontal disease, malocclusions, missing teeth, and some dentures. This was not the case in the skulls from the prehistoric periods...
The arch is the part of the upper jaw inside the "U" formed by the teeth. Narrow dental arches are a characteristic feature of malocclusion-prone societies. The importance of arch development is something that I'll be coming back to repeatedly. Dr. Palmer's paper includes the following example of prehistoric (L) and modern (R) arches:


Dr. Palmer used an extreme example of a modern arch to illustrate his point, however, arches of this width are not uncommon today. Milder forms of this narrowing affect the majority of the population in industrial nations.

In 1962, Dr. D.H. Goose published a
study of 403 British skulls from four historical periods: Romano-British, Saxon, medieval and modern (3). He found that the arches of modern skulls were less broad than at any previous time in history. This followed an earlier study showing that modern British skulls had more frequent malocclusion than historical skulls (4). Goose stated that:
Although irregularities of the teeth can occur in earlier populations, for example in the Saxon skulls studied by Smyth (1934), the narrowing of the palate seems to have occurred in too short a period to be an evolutionary change. Hooton (1946) thinks it is a speeding up of an already long standing change under conditions of city life.
Dr. Robert Corruccini published several papers documenting narrowed arches in one generation of dietary change, or in genetically similar populations living rural or urban lifestyles (reviewed in reference #5). One was a st
udy of Caucasians in Kentucky, in which a change from a traditional subsistence diet to modern industrial food habits accompanied a marked narrowing of arches and increase in malocclusion in one generation. Another study examined older and younger generations of Pima Native Americans, which again showed a reduction in arch width in one generation. A third compared rural and urban Indians living in the vicinity of Chandigarh, showing marked differences in arch breadth and the prevalence of malocclusion between the two genetically similar populations. Corruccini states:
In Chandigarh, processed food predominates, while in the country coarse millet and locally grown vegetables are staples. Raw sugar cane is widely chewed for enjoyment rurally [interestingly, the rural group had the lowest incidence of tooth decay], and in the country dental care is lacking, being replaced by chewing on acacia boughs which clean the teeth and are considered medicinal.
Dr. Weston Price came to the same conclusion examining prehistoric skulls from South America, Australia and New Zealand, as well as their living counterparts throughout the world that had adhered to traditional cultures and foodways. From Nutrition and Physical Degeneration:
In a study of several hundred skulls taken from the burial mounds of southern Florida, the incidence of tooth decay was so low as to constitute an immunity of apparently one hundred per cent, since in several hundred skulls not a single tooth was found to have been attacked by tooth decay. Dental arch deformity and the typical change in facial form due to an inadequate nutrition were also completely absent, all dental arches having a form and interdental relationship [occlusion] such as to bring them into the classification of normal.
Price found that the modern descendants of this culture, eating processed food, suffered from malocclusion and narrow arches, while another group from the same culture living traditionally did not. Here's one of Dr. Price's images from Nutrition and Physical Degeneration (p. 212). This skull is from a prehistoric New Zealand Maori hunter-gatherer:


Note the well-formed third molars (wisdom teeth) in both of the prehistoric skulls I've posted. These people had ample room for them in their broad arches. Third molar crowding is a mild form of modern face/jaw deformity, and affects the majority of modern populations. It's the reason people have their wisdom teeth removed. Urban Nigerians in Lagos have 10 times more third molar crowding than rural Nigerians in the same state (10.7% of molars vs. 1.1%, reference #6).

Straight teeth and good occlusion are the human evolutionary norm. They're also accompanied by a wide dental arch and ample room for third molars in many traditionally-living cultures. The combination of narrow arches, malocclusion, third molar crowding, small or absent sinuses, and a characteristic underdevelopment of the middle third of the face, are part of a developmental syndrome that predominantly afflicts industrially living cultures.

Malocclusion: Disease of Civilization

In his epic work Nutrition and Physical Degeneration, Dr. Weston Price documented the abnormal dental development and susceptibility to tooth decay that accompanied the adoption of modern foods in a number of different cultures throughout the world. Although he quantified changes in cavity prevalence (sometimes finding increases as large as 1,000-fold), all we have are Price's anecdotes describing the crooked teeth, narrow arches and "dished" faces these cultures developed as they modernized.

Price published the first edition of his book in 1939. Fortunately,
Nutrition and Physical Degeneration wasn't the last word on the matter. Anthropologists and archaeologists have been extending Price's findings throughout the 20th century. My favorite is Dr. Robert S. Corruccini, currently a professor of anthropology at Southern Illinois University. He published a landmark paper in 1984 titled "An Epidemiologic Transition in Dental Occlusion in World Populations" that will be our starting point for a discussion of how diet and lifestyle factors affect the development of the teeth, skull and jaw (Am J. Orthod. 86(5):419)*.

First, some background. The word
occlusion refers to the manner in which the top and bottom sets of teeth come together, determined in part by the alignment between the upper jaw (maxilla) and lower jaw (mandible). There are three general categories:
  • Class I occlusion: considered "ideal". The bottom incisors (front teeth) fit just behind the top incisors.
  • Class II occlusion: "overbite." The bottom incisors are too far behind the top incisors. The mandible may appear small.
  • Class III occlusion: "underbite." The bottom incisors are beyond the top incisors. The mandible protrudes.
Malocclusion means the teeth do not come together in a way that's considered ideal. The term "class I malocclusion" is sometimes used to describe crowded incisors when the jaws are aligning properly.

Over the course of the next several posts, I'll give an overview of the extensive literature showing that hunter-gatherers past and present have excellent occlusion, subsistence agriculturalists generally have good occlusion, and the adoption of modern foodways directly causes the crooked teeth, narrow arches and/or crowded third molars (wisdom teeth) that affect the majority of people in industrialized nations. I believe this process also affects the development of the rest of the skull, including the face and sinuses.


In his 1984 paper, Dr. Corruccini reviewed data from a number of cultures whose occlusion has been studied in detail. Most of these cultures were observed by Dr. Corruccini personally. He compared two sets of cultures: those that adhere to a traditional style of life and those that have adopted industrial foodways. For several of the cultures he studied, he compared it to another that was genetically similar. For example, the older generation of Pima indians vs. the younger generation, and rural vs. urban Punjabis. He also included data from archaeological sites and nonhuman primates. Wild animals, including nonhuman primates, almost invariably show perfect occlusion.

The last graph in the paper is the most telling. He compiled all the occlusion data into a single number called the "treatment priority index" (TPI). This is a number that represents the overall need for orthodontic treatment. A TPI of 4 or greater indicates malocclusion (the cutoff point is subjective and depends somewhat on aesthetic considerations). Here's the graph: Every single urban/industrial culture has an average TPI of greater than 4, while all the non-industrial or less industrial cultures have an average TPI below 4. This means that in industrial cultures, the average person requires orthodontic treatment to achieve good occlusion, whereas most people in more traditionally-living cultures naturally have good occlusion.

The best occlusion was in the New Britain sample, a precontact Melanesian hunter-gatherer group studied from archaeological remains. The next best occlusion was in the Libben and Dickson groups, who were early Native American agriculturalists. The Pima represent the older generation of Native Americans that was raised on a somewhat traditional agricultural diet, vs. the younger generation raised on processed reservation foods. The Chinese samples are immigrants and their descendants in Liverpool. The Punjabis represent urban vs. rural youths in Northern India. The Kentucky samples represent a traditionally-living Appalachian community, older generation vs. processed food-eating offspring. The "early black" and "black youths" samples represent older and younger generations of African-Americans in the Cleveland and St. Louis area. The "white parents/youths" sample represents different generations of American Caucasians.


The point is clear: there's something about industrialization that causes malocclusion. It's not genetic; it's a result of changes in diet and/or lifestyle. A "disease of civilization". I use that phrase loosely, because malocclusion isn't really a disease, and some cultures that qualify as civilizations retain traditional foodways and relatively good teeth. Nevertheless, it's a time-honored phrase that encompasses the wide array of health problems that occur when humans stray too far from their ecological niche.
I'm going to let Dr. Corruccini wrap this post up for me:
I assert that these results serve to modify two widespread generalizations: that imperfect occlusion is not necessarily abnormal, and that prevalence of malocclusion is genetically controlled so that preventive therapy in the strict sense is not possible. Cross-cultural data dispel the notion that considerable occlusal variation [malocclusion] is inevitable or normal. Rather, it is an aberrancy of modern urbanized populations. Furthermore, the transition from predominantly good to predominantly bad occlusion repeatedly occurs within one or two generations' time in these (and other) populations, weakening arguments that explain high malocclusion prevalence genetically.
